D.El.Ed – Diploma in Elementary Education
Overview
D.El.Ed is a 2-year diploma course designed to train aspiring teachers for the primary/elementary level (Classes I to VIII). It focuses on child psychology, pedagogy, classroom management, and foundational teaching skills.
The first step for those passionate about shaping young minds.
Key Highlights
- NCTE-recognized teacher training program
- Prepares candidates to teach classes I–VIII
- Includes practical teaching, internships, and workshops
- Focus on multilingual learning, inclusive education & activity-based methods
Eligibility & Duration
- ✅ Eligibility:
- 10+2 (any stream) with minimum 50% marks
- ⏳ Duration: 2 years (4 semesters)
Is It Worth It?
Yes! It’s mandatory for primary-level teachers in most schools and opens doors for government teacher eligibility tests like CTET, TET, etc.
Career Scope
- Primary/Upper Primary School Teacher
- Private school teaching
- Government teacher after passing TET/CTET
- Tutor, Teaching Assistant, NGO Educator

B.Ed – Bachelor of Education
Overview
B.Ed is a 2-year professional degree that qualifies you to teach at secondary and higher secondary levels. It blends theory and practice in modern pedagogy and educational psychology.
An essential stepping stone for teaching careers in India.
Key Highlights
- NCTE-approved program
- Mandatory for teaching Classes VI to XII
- Practical training, lesson planning, school internships
- Specialized methodology subjects (Science, Math, Languages, etc.)
Eligibility & Duration
- ✅ Eligibility:
- Graduation in any stream with at least 50% marks
- ⏳ Duration: 2 years (4 semesters)
Is It Worth It?
Absolutely. B.Ed is compulsory for teaching jobs in schools (private and government), and a gateway to further education roles and promotions.
Career Scope
- TGT (Trained Graduate Teacher) or PGT
- School Teacher (Classes 6–12)
- Government teacher after qualifying TET/CTET
- Academic Coordinator, Private Tutor
- Gateway to M.Ed or PhD in Education

M.Ed – Master of Education
Overview
M.Ed is a 2-year postgraduate program in education, ideal for those who want to become teacher educators, researchers, or academic leaders.
A deep dive into educational leadership and advanced pedagogy.
Key Highlights
- Postgraduate degree for B.Ed graduates
- Offers research, specialization, and academic depth
- Focuses on curriculum development, psychology, and education tech
- Required for lecturer positions in B.Ed/D.El.Ed colleges
Eligibility & Duration
- ✅ Eligibility:
- B.Ed with minimum 50–55% marks
- ⏳ Duration: 2 years (4 semesters)
Is It Worth It?
Yes! M.Ed is essential for teacher education, leadership roles in educational policy, curriculum development, and academic research.
Career Scope
- Lecturer in D.El.Ed/B.Ed Colleges
- Curriculum Developer / Education Researcher
- Academic Administrator
- School Principal or Coordinator
- Start PhD in Education
